It’s slightly ironic that a system centered on delivering hard copy communications has one of the world’s largest Information Technology (IT) infrastructures. But once you consider that the U.S. Postal Service has more than 31,000 retail locations, hundreds of thousands of employees, and 8,500 pieces of automated mail processing equipment, it makes sense.
